The prestigious Kavli Prizes recognize scientists for major advances in three research areas: astrophysics, nanoscience and neuroscience—the big, the small and the complex. The 2016 winners, sharing a cash award of $1 million in each field, will be announced via live satellite from the Norwegian Academy of Science and Letters in Oslo.
